Basketball Recap: Goreville Blackcats vs. Sesser-Valier/Waltonville Red Devils
Goreville was not able to break out of their rough patch on Wednesday as the team picked up their 15th straight defeat dating back to last season. They had to suffer through a 41-14 loss at the hands of the Sesser-Valier/Waltonville Red Devils. The contest marked the Blackcats' lowest-scoring game so far this season.
Lydia Kwiatkowski was Goreville's leading scorer, having posted six points. Kwiatkowski also led the team in rebounds with eight. Chasey Peas took the lead distributing the ball, coming up with three assists.
Goreville's loss dropped their record down to 0-14. As for Sesser-Valier/Waltonville, the victory was the fifth in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 12-4.
Goreville w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next match, a 66-29 defeat against Anna-Jonesboro on the 16th. As for Sesser-Valier/Waltonville, they will face off against Herrin at 5:00 p.m. on Monday. Sesser-Valier/Waltonville is facing Herrin at the right time seeing as Herrin is stuck on a seven-game losing streak.
